Severe snow storms have hit the eastern regions of the United States endangering the lives of millions of people, with very low temperatures, snow accumulation and power outage, 31 storm-related deaths were reported. A deepening crisis unfolded in western New York where many were trapped by a blizzard, while emergency services were unable to reach hard-hit areas.

Temperatures in 48 states dropped below freezing over the weekend, thousands of flights were canceled and residents were forced to stay indoors covered in snow.

The dangerous conditions prompted New York Governor Kathy Hochul to call in 200 members of the National Guard to assist in the rescue operations. “The conditions were “extremely dangerous and fatal,” Hochul told CNN, noting that even National Guard units had been stuck and had to be rescued.

A senior official ruled out that electricity will be restored as soon as possible, noting that one of the substations was buried under 18 feet of snow.
